Businesses and self-employed affected by emergencies: 30 days to access guarantees for financing provided to third parties

The resolution publishes the terms of the first phase of the guarantee line to cover financing provided by financial entities to businesses and self-employed affected by civil protection emergencies. This mechanism is regulated by art. 2 of RDL 12/2025 and art. 22 of RDL 5/2026, allowing affected parties to access guarantees on behalf of the State within 30 days of emergency notification. A key condition is that the financing was granted by financial entities to third parties.

In 2 key points

  1. Access to state guarantees within 30 days after an emergency (art. 22 del Real Decreto-ley 5/2026, de 17 de febrero)
  2. Financing provided by financial institutions to third parties is a prerequisite (art. 2 del Real Decreto-ley 12/2025, de 28 de octubre)

How it affects those involved

For businesses and self-employed individuals affected by civil protection emergencies, direct access to state guarantees is available, reducing financial risks. Financial institutions can obtain guarantees for loans granted to third parties. Advisors must verify whether the case meets the emergency criteria and the type of financing. The Ministry of Economy and the Official Credit Institute manage the process and set the coverage limits.
